لینوکس, مدیریت سرور لینوکس

آموزش باز کردن پورت در اوبونتو (Ubuntu)

آموزش باز کردن پورت در اوبونتو (Ubuntu)

در این مقاله قصد داریم روش باز کردن پورت در اوبونتو (Ubuntu) را بررسی کنیم، برنامه ها و سرویس های مختلف از پورت های خاصی برای سرویس دهی استفاده می کنند که بعضی از این پورت ها به صورت پیش فرض روی سرور اوبونتو بسته هستند و لازم است با دستوراتی که در اینجا آموزش می دهیم پورت را در لینوکس اوبونتو باز کنید.

برای استفاده از هر سرویس و یا نرم افزار علاوه بر نصب و راه اندازی آن نیاز است تا پورت یا رنج پورت های مرتبط با آن نیز در فایروال سیستم عامل Ubuntu باز شوند. برخی از سرویس ها بعداز نصب به صورت پیش فرض پورت مرتبط را نیز در فایروال سیستم عامل باز می کنند ولی برای بیشتر سرویس ها و نرم افزارها باید اینکار به صورت دستی صورت پذیرد.

روش بازکردن پورت در اوبونتو (Ubuntu)

ابتدا از طریق نام کاربری root به سرور خود SSH بزنید. سپس برای آگاهی از پورت هایی که هم اکنون برروی فایروال باز می باشند دستور ذیل را وارد نمایید :

iptables –L

اگر پورت یا رنج پورت مورد نظر شما در لیست پورت های باز موجود نبود می باید برای باز کردن پورت یا رنج پورت مربوطه اقدام با توجه به توضیحات ذیل اقدام نمایید :

باز کردن پورت خاص :

اگر پورت مورد نظر از نوع tcp می باشد باید از شکل کلی دستور ذیل استفاده نمایید :

iptables -A INPUT -p tcp –dport <Port-Number> -j ACCEPT

اگر پورت مورد نظر از نوع udp می باشد باید از شکل کلی دستور ذیل استفاده نمایید :

iptables -A INPUT -p udp –dport <Port-Number> -j ACCEPT

توجه داشته باشید که در دستورات بالا می باید به جای عبارت <Port-Number> شماره پورت مورد نظر خود را وارد نمایید.

در انتها به جهت ذخیره سازی تنظیمات اعمال شده دستور ذیل را وارد نمایید :

iptables-save

آموزش باز کردن پورت در اوبونتو (Ubuntu)

باز کردن رنج پورت خاص :

در صورتیکه رنج پورت مورد نظر از نوع tcp می باشد باید از شکل کلی دستور ذیل استفاده نمایید :

iptables -A INPUT -p tcp –dport <Start-Port-Number>:<End-Port-Number> -j ACCEPT

در صورتیکه رنج پورت مورد نظر از نوع udp می باشد باید از شکل کلی دستور ذیل استفاده نمایید :

iptables -A INPUT -p udp –dport <Start-Port-Number>:<End-Port-Number> -j ACCEPT

توجه داشته باشید که در دستورات بالا می باید به جای عبارات <Start-Port-Number> و <End-Port-Number> به ترتیب شماره پورت شروع و شماره پورت پایان از رنج پورت مورد نظر خود را وارد نمایید.

در انتها به جهت ذخیره سازی تنظیمات اعمال شده دستور ذیل را وارد نمایید :

iptables-save

لازم به ذکر است که دستورات استارت، استاپ، ریستارت و مشاهده وضعیت فایروال به ترتیب به صورت ذیل می باشد :

service ufw start
service ufw stop
service ufw restart

خب باز کردن پورت در اوبونتو با موفقیت به پایان رسید، امیدواریم این آموزش برای شما مفید بوده باشد.

مطالب مرتبط

1 نظر در “آموزش باز کردن پورت در اوبونتو (Ubuntu)

  1. علی گفت:

    سلام من یک سرور از ابرآروان خریدم همه اینکارایی که گفتین کردم هیچ اروری هم نداد ولی خب از طریق سایت های پورت چِکِر مثله portchecker.io که آی‌دی سرور و پورت موردنظرم (5055) رو که میزنم، میگه بسته هست!!! مشکل چیه؟

    لطفا پاسخ تون رو بهم ایمیل هم بکنید. ممنون

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*